Goa, July 27 -- The dumping of mud for the construction of a temporary road through agricultural fields in Guirim by the Water Rersources Department and Goa Electricity Department has sparked concern among local farmers and the Guirim Comunidade.
Tulio D'Souza, President of the Guirim Comunidade, stated that although permission had been granted to the electricity department to erect high-tension transmission towers in fields, it was given on the condition that no inconvenience or damage would be caused to farmers or the farmland.
